George Thorogood & The Destroyers kick off the latest leg of their Good to Be Bad: 45 Years of Rock tour this Saturday, June 22, in Hinckley, Minnesota. The North American trek features over 30 dates and is scheduled through an October 19 show in Battle Creek, Michigan.
Thorogood, 69, tells ABC Radio that he and his band constantly strive to put on a better show than they’ve ever done before.
“I don’t want people to come see The Destroyers and say, ‘Wow, you should’ve seen ’em 10 years ago,'” George declares. “Somebody says that to me, and then I’m done. I want someone to say, ‘You gotta see ’em right now,’ and that’s what we work at no matter where we go.”
Thorogood says he loves playing for both old and new fans, but when it comes to the people who have already seen the band, he wants them to say, “Oh my goodness, who was that guy who played here last year? This guy’s much better than the Thorogood we heard five years ago.”
George adds, “[T]hat’s the essence of what our band is about… That’s how you stay on top of your game.”
Meanwhile, George says he’s excited about the new limited-edition signature guitar Gibson created for him — the Epiphone “White Fang” ES-125TDC Outfit, inspired by a 1959 Epiphone hollowbody he long favored.
“It’s more than special on a personal level,” Thorogood says. “It means someone out there really cares about what [I’m] doing… And they’re saying, ‘We’re gonna [design a guitar] that’s gonna make George even be more of what George has already been.’ So if I was obnoxious before, forget it, I’ll be illegal the next time I play.”
